Continue ReadingThe Toledo area offenses looked great. We’re highlighting some of the best standout performances from this past week.
Kevin Hornbeak – Whitmer – QB – 6’2″ 265 lbs
Hornbeak was able to lead Whitmer to a surprising beatdown of Findlay on Friday. He had a clean pocket most of the night and was able to sit back and pick the defense apart. He made a bunch of great throws, a handful of nice ones, and then a few he wishes he could have back. He is a big QB and he’s very hard to tackle. He’s not the best running QB, but when he gets going and full speed, he’s not easy to bring down. It was a fantastic performance in a game where everyone was watching.
Sam Lee – Central Catholic – WR/LB – 6’6″ 210 lbs
Lee played both ways on Friday but he really only impacted the game on the offensive side of the ball. Right before the half, the offense finally got going and Lee was the reason they were able to jumpstart the offense. He made an awesome grab on the sideline, broke a tackle, and raced into the endzone for the score. He wasn’t done yet as in the second half he was on the receiving end of 6 new 1st downs.
Logan Werner – Clay – RB/LB – 6’3″ 205 lbs
Due to injury and some other personnel issues, Werner got more work on Friday and he absolutely delivered. In the 1st quarter, he broke a run to the outside, made a defender miss, and found the endzone for the score. He was reliable on Friday and never once got tackled behind the line of scrimmage. He showed that he’s a pretty decent athlete out of the backfield as well.
Kamar Johnson – Lima Senior – RB – 5’8″ 165 lbs
Normally a Lima school wouldn’t be on the list, but they played in Toledo on Friday and Johnson made some plays worth recognition. He made one of the most incredible 20-yard TD runs you’ll ever see as well. He weaved through the defense, cut it back, and then dragged 2 defenders into the endzone with him. He later made another big run that helped ice the game for Lima Senior.

Anytime you watch a Perrysburg game you’re looking for Walendzak and he always delivers. Friday was no different as a sliced Napoleon’s defense like swiss cheese. He was making guys miss, running them over, and fueling the entire stadium. Walendzak found the endzone early and never slowed. He shows elite acceleration and contact balance anytime he touches the ball. He’s a threat with the ball in his hands and Friday he helped carry Perrysburg to an easy win.
